Based on the m-core-nilpotent decomposition, we introduce a generalized inverse named the m-MP weak core inverse, which unifies the CMP inverse and the MP weak core inverse. Some properties, characterizations and representations of this generalized inverse are shown. Then, the relationship between the m-MP weak core inverse and a nonsingular bordered matrix is established. A variant of the successive squaring computational iterative scheme is given for calculating the m-MP weak core inverse. An equivalent condition for the continuity for the m-MP weak core inverse is also studied. In the final, the m-MP weak core inverse is used in solving a system of linear equations.
